Online retailers are failing to tap into the highly lucrative gift sales
market by wasting resources on shopping tools and services that are of
little interest to potential buyers, according to a study released
Monday by Forrester Research.


As part of its report on "The Hidden Value in Gift Sales," the Cambridge,
Massachusetts-based firm concluded that on-time delivery -- rather than wish
lists or gift-wrapping options -- has a greater effect on e-tail success
because it produces a "positive experience" for the recipient.
